The questions

1 What theatrical legacy did Mathew Prichard receive on his ninth birthday?
2 What conditions does the Tdap vaccine protect against?
3 The bestselling book in the US in 1981 was a guide to solving what?
4 What is selected each year at the Melodifestivalen?
5 Carpetbaggers were profiteers in the aftermath of which conflict?
6 The confectionery lokum is better known as what?
7 In 1996, which UK sport moved from a winter to a summer season?
8 Who founded the Peripatetic school of philosophy?
What links:
9
Thomas Tyers; Hester Piozzi; John Hawkins; James Boswell?
10 Admiralty Islands; New Britain; New Hanover; New Ireland?
11 Millbank, 1897; Merseyside, 1988; Cornwall, 1993; Bankside, 2000?
12 Sodium (1); carbon (2); oxygen (3); sulphur (4); tin (10)?
13 Kelpie; melusine; naiad; nixie; rusalka; selkie?
14 Igor Tudor at Spurs; Eric Ramsay at WBA; Brian Clough and Jock Stein at Leeds?
15 Made in America; -30-; Felina; Person to Person; The Iron Throne?

The answers

1 Rights to Agatha Christie’s play The Mousetrap (he was her grandson).
2 Tetanus, diphtheria and pertussis (whooping cough).
3 Rubik’s Cube.
4 Sweden’s Eurovision entry.
5 American civil war.
6 Turkish delight.
7 Rugby league.
8 Aristotle
9 Wrote biographies of Samuel Johnson (in publication order).
10 Main components of the Bismarck Archipelago in the south-west Pacific.
11 Tate gallery openings: Britain; Liverpool; St Ives; Modern.
12 Number of stable isotopes of chemical elements.
13 Water spirits in European folklore.
14 44-day football managerial tenures.
15 Final episodes of “golden age” TV series: The Sopranos; The Wire; Breaking Bad; Mad Men; Game of Thrones.
